> The folks in the i18n team has made a great new tool for us to use,
> which is live on Meta right now:
[[
Special:TranslatorSignup<https://meta.wikimedia.org/wiki/Special:Transla…>]].
> What it does is that it lets you be notified when there are new pages for
> translations. You sign up on that page, specifying what languages you are
> willing to translate into, how you would like to be notified (e-mail, Meta
> talk page or talk page on another wiki), and how often you would like to be
> notified. This will make it much easier to target people by language, so
> when we have something that only needs to be translated into, say,
> Romanian, only people who speak Romanian will get the notification about
> that.
